"Save as Draft"
It would be helpful if there were also a "Save as Draft" button at the top, in addition to the one at the bottom, of grant applications, etc. Or at least a message somewhere near the Question Legend icon at the top informing users that they need to regularly save and the button to do this is at the bottom of the page.

Hi Dee Ann,
In the 4.1.0 release in early February, we changed the forms so that they auto-save as the applicant answers each question. This essentially removes the need for "Save as Draft".
This should provide a much better experience for most of our users. Thanks again for the suggestion,
